Hello fellow Bronco enthusiasts,
I recently purchased a Procal4 for my Bronco, and I'm having some issues with the upgrade process when connecting it to my PC. I was hoping to get some advice and insights from the community here.
Issue: When I connect my Procal4 to my PC, I am unable to perform the upgrade as intended. The software doesn't seem to work as expected, and I'm at a loss as to what might be causing the problem.
What I've Tried So Far:
I've followed the instructions provided with the Procal4 to the letter.
I've ensured that my PC meets the system requirements.
I've checked for any driver updates, but everything seems up-to-date.
I've attempted the process multiple times, but with no success.
Questions:
Has anyone else encountered a similar issue with their Procal4 and PC connection?
Are there any troubleshooting steps or tips you can share to help me resolve this problem?
Is there any specific software or firmware I should be aware of to make the upgrade smoother?
I appreciate any guidance or advice you can offer. Your experience and expertise will be invaluable in helping me get my Bronco up and running with the Procal4. Thank you in advance for your assistance!

I had the same issue. Tried 3 different Windows based laptops and got the same error. After the 3rd laptop, I realized it was NOT the PC having issues. I solved the problem by “brute force”, relentlessly clicking on the “try again” button on the pop up and eventually forcing the update push to Ford’s server. After that, installing it on the truck was flawless. Hope that helps.
